How do you make decisions? Luck? Hard work? Sense of timing?

By Gary | July 23, 2008

It's been said that "luck" really never comes without hard work. One common "adage" I've heard a lot regarding online marketing is this one: "I find that the harder I work the luckier I get."

I would add that "luck" or good fortune or success in career and life in general often is a matter of timing. That means, you stay focus and get organized, and with a lot of hard work -- you find your "timing" getting better, regarding work, relationships, and life in general.

I've often found myself struggling with this issue of timing. Sometimes I think I'm the sort of guy who causes rainstorms because I choose to wash my car. Or perhaps like the guy who looks into Outer Banks rentals for a vacation trip during hurricane season?

Well, maybe not that extreme. But I've sometimes said to my wife, when faced with career decisions, that it really doesn't matter which of two options I choose, it'll be the wrong one. In my less cynical moments, of course, I agree with her when she tells me that's unlikely if not impossible.

In the end, I know that hard work and focus are the "keys" to success, not luck or not some capriciousness of the universe. We develop "timing" and find "luck" as we organize ourselves, study, study, study, work hard, and get on with life's daily decisions.
